Output 800049c813b7dba31aab8a715fac53e8ceddca1ed15b515fa191d7e976061e88:1

value
6958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7faa3a86de6fdafb73b59848df4c60410116f60e OP_EQUAL
address
3DL3fbeKjBBeeTS9YFG3bdMKYLb8HXBLVw
transaction
800049c813b7dba31aab8a715fac53e8ceddca1ed15b515fa191d7e976061e88
confirmations
21024
spent
true